📚About the Program
Shantou University Medical College (SUMC), founded in 1983 and located in Shantou, China, is a prominent institution in the field of medical education. Nestled in a coastal city known for its rich culture and subtropical climate, SUMC stands out as a key center for medical research and training, leveraging its strategic location within one of China's Special Economic Zones.
The Master’s in Public Health and Preventive Medicine at SUMC is designed to equip students with the essential knowledge and skills to address public health challenges effectively. Over three years, students will engage in comprehensive studies that cover topics such as epidemiology, health policy, and preventive strategies, preparing them for impactful careers in public health, government agencies, and international organizations. The program's emphasis on multidisciplinary approaches and innovative teaching methods ensures that graduates are well-prepared to lead initiatives that improve community health outcomes.
